Transaction 657994744dbd781d824d6786c37b84a9d13b7206e7e763c9d3f58d0788bc7320

1 Input
2 Outputs
  • 657994744dbd781d824d6786c37b84a9d13b7206e7e763c9d3f58d0788bc7320:0
  • value  359990
    address  36F77k6No9GVe6Tee3JLXLcqopcYo6wiv9
  • 657994744dbd781d824d6786c37b84a9d13b7206e7e763c9d3f58d0788bc7320:1
  • value  284885840
    address  3MfJXEX9CTN25fdtCqypi2c8FncVhEYKEL